package org.apache.jena.sparql.algebra.op;
import java.util.Objects;
import org.apache.jena.atlas.lib.Lib ;
import org.apache.jena.sparql.algebra.Op ;
import org.apache.jena.sparql.algebra.OpVisitor ;
import org.apache.jena.sparql.algebra.Transform ;
import org.apache.jena.sparql.sse.Tags ;
import org.apache.jena.sparql.util.NodeIsomorphismMap ;
/** Do-nothing class that means that tags/labels/comments can be left in the algebra tree.
* If serialized, toString called on the object, reparsing yields a string.
* Can have zero one sub ops. */
public class OpLabel extends Op1
{
// Beware : while this is a Op1, it might have no sub operation.
// (label "foo") and (label "foo" (other ...)) are legal.
// Better: string+(object for internal use only)+op?
public static Op create(Object label, Op op) { return new OpLabel(label, op) ; }
private Object object ;
protected OpLabel(Object thing) { this(thing, null) ; }
protected OpLabel(Object thing, Op op) {
super(op) ;
this.object = thing ;
}
@Override
public boolean equalTo(Op other, NodeIsomorphismMap labelMap) {
if ( !(other instanceof OpLabel) )
return false ;
OpLabel opLabel = (OpLabel)other ;
if ( !Objects.equals(object, opLabel.object) )
return false ;
return Objects.equals(getSubOp(), opLabel.getSubOp()) ;
}
@Override
public int hashCode() {
int x = HashLabel ;
x ^= Lib.hashCodeObject(object, 0) ;
x ^= Lib.hashCodeObject(getSubOp(), 0) ;
return x ;
}
@Override
public void visit(OpVisitor opVisitor)
{ opVisitor.visit(this) ; }
public Object getObject() { return object ; }
public boolean hasSubOp() { return getSubOp() != null ; }
@Override
public String getName() {
return Tags.tagLabel ;
}
@Override
public Op apply(Transform transform, Op subOp)
{ return transform.transform(this, subOp) ; }
@Override
public Op1 copy(Op subOp) {
return new OpLabel(object, subOp) ;
}
}
